web前端要求会什么
-
Web前端开发要求掌握以下几个方面的知识和技能:
-
HTML和CSS:HTML是用于定义网页结构的标记语言,CSS用于定义网页的样式和布局。前端开发人员需要熟悉HTML标签的使用和CSS样式的控制,能够构建符合设计要求的网页。
-
JavaScript:作为前端开发的核心语言,JavaScript负责处理网页的交互和动态效果。开发人员需要了解JavaScript的基本语法、DOM操作、事件处理等,能够编写简单的脚本及交互效果。
-
前端框架和库:掌握常见的前端框架和库,如React、Vue、Angular等,能够利用这些工具来提高开发效率和代码质量。
-
响应式设计和移动端开发:现代网页设计要求能够适配不同屏幕尺寸的设备。了解响应式设计的原理,熟悉移动端开发的适配方式和技巧,能够开发出适应性强的网页。
-
浏览器兼容性和性能优化:不同浏览器对网页的支持和解析存在差异,前端开发人员需要了解不同浏览器的特性和兼容性问题,能够编写出兼容性良好的代码。同时,对网页性能进行优化,提高页面加载速度和用户体验,也是前端开发要关注的重点。
-
版本管理和代码调试:掌握常用的版本管理工具,如Git,能够进行团队协作和代码版本控制。同时,熟练使用浏览器的开发者工具,能够进行代码调试和性能分析,解决代码中的错误和问题。
总结起来,Web前端开发要求掌握HTML、CSS、JavaScript等基础技术,并熟悉常用的前端框架和库,具备响应式设计和移动端开发的能力,能够处理浏览器兼容性和性能优化问题,同时掌握版本管理和代码调试的技能。
1年前 -
-
作为一个有效的Web前端开发人员,你需要具备以下技能和能力:
-
HTML和CSS:你应该熟练掌握HTML(超文本标记语言)和CSS(层叠样式表),作为构建网页的基础元素。你应该了解HTML标签的结构、语义和用法,以及如何使用CSS样式来控制和美化页面的外观。
-
JavaScript:JavaScript是Web前端开发中最重要的编程语言之一。你需要熟悉JavaScript的语法和基本概念,包括变量、数据类型、运算符、流控制等。你还应该熟悉DOM(文档对象模型)操作,用于与网页中的元素进行交互和更新。
-
响应式设计:随着移动设备的普及,响应式设计已成为Web前端开发的标准实践。你应该了解并掌握响应式设计的原理和技术,使你设计的网页能够适应不同的屏幕大小和设备类型。
-
前端框架和库:熟悉常用的前端框架(如React、Vue.js)和库(如jQuery)有助于提高开发效率和代码质量。这些框架和库提供了丰富的功能和组件,帮助你快速搭建复杂的用户界面。
-
版本控制系统:诸如Git这样的版本控制系统对于团队协作和代码管理至关重要。熟悉版本控制系统的基本概念和操作,包括代码提交、分支管理和合并等,可以使你更好地与团队合作,并保持代码的版本控制和追踪。
此外,还有一些其他的技能和能力,包括:
- 跨浏览器兼容性:确保你的网页在不同的浏览器和操作系统中能够正确显示和运行。
- 性能优化:优化网页加载速度和性能,减少资源的请求和使用,提升用户体验。
- SEO优化:了解基本的搜索引擎优化原则和技巧,使你的网页在搜索引擎中得到更好的排名和曝光。
- 软件工程和测试:对软件工程原理和开发流程有一定的了解,能够进行软件测试和调试,确保代码的质量和可靠性。
- 用户体验设计:了解基本的用户体验设计原则,包括用户界面设计、用户行为分析等,使你的网页更加易于使用和吸引用户。
综上所述,作为一名Web前端开发人员,你需要掌握HTML和CSS、JavaScript、响应式设计、前端框架和库、版本控制系统等技能和能力,同时还需要了解其他相关的前端开发领域,以提升自己的专业水平和竞争力。
1年前 -
-
作为一个Web前端工程师,需要具备一定的技术和能力。以下是一些Web前端要求的技术和能力:
-
HTML/CSS:熟悉HTML(超文本标记语言)和CSS(层叠样式表),能够编写结构清晰、样式美观的网页。
-
JavaScript:精通JavaScript,能够使用JavaScript编写交互性强的网页,并实现动态效果。
-
前端框架:熟悉并掌握至少一种前端框架,如Angular、React或Vue.js等。这些框架可以提供更高效、可维护的网页开发方式。
-
UI/UX设计:具备一定的UI(用户界面)和UX(用户体验)设计能力,能够设计出简洁、易用的界面。
-
响应式设计:熟悉响应式设计的原理和实践,能够使网页在不同尺寸和设备上有良好的显示效果。
-
浏览器兼容性:了解主流浏览器的兼容性问题,能够编写兼容各种浏览器的代码。
-
调试和优化:具备良好的调试和优化能力,能够解决代码中的bug,并优化网页的性能。
-
版本控制:熟悉使用版本控制系统,如Git,能够与团队成员协同开发。
-
SEO(搜索引擎优化):了解SEO的基本原理,能够使网页在搜索引擎中有较好的排名。
-
网络知识:了解HTTP协议和网络安全知识,能够进行网页性能调优和网络安全防护。
此外,作为一个优秀的Web前端工程师,还需要具备良好的团队合作能力、自我学习和持续进修的能力,以及良好的沟通能力。能够与设计师、后端开发人员和产品经理等团队成员进行有效的沟通和合作,共同完成项目开发。
1年前 -